Energy policy has become a contentious issue in Taiwan. Amid the summer heat, occasional blackouts create public unrest. Meanwhile, Taipei continues to implement policy from the last decade to transition Taiwan鈥檚 energy production away from coal and nuclear and toward liquefied natural gas (LNG) and renewables like solar, hydroelectric, and wind power. While renewables increase Taiwan鈥檚 ability to generate electricity domestically, the island鈥攚hich is roughly the size of Maryland鈥攔emains mostly dependent on imported coal, LNG, and nuclear material.

Join Hudson as an expert panel discusses the current state of Taiwan鈥檚 energy transition and how the island鈥檚 energy mix might change in the next several years.
